Lassa Fever: FG launches National Call Centre
In an effort to nip in the bud cases of Lassa Fever and other public health emergencies, the Federal Government has launched a National Call Centre.
The Call Centre will be domiciled at the Nigeria Centre for Disease Control (NCDC).
While launching the Centre in Abuja, yesterday, the Minister of Health, Isaac Adewole, explained that the introduction of the Centre is a demonstration of the determination of the President Buhari-led
government to provide easy access to health care services and information to all Nigerians.
He, however, advised Nigerians to avail themselves of the opportunity provided by the Centre to assist the government in its determination to prevent communicable diseases, especially the current Lassa fever outbreak.
Adewole therefore, called on citizens who have symptoms of Lassa Fever to call any of the ten (10) numbers 097000010 to 19 from anywhere in the country and such will be directed to the appropriate state Epidemiologist or refer them to the nearest health facility.
In a statement by the Director, Media and Public Relations of the ministry, Boade Akinola (Mrs), the minister promised that: “where possible, patients could be picked-up from their locations and takento the nearest health facility.
He assured that any one that uses the call facility will get prompt response.
